Chinese medicine practitioners mostly prescribe traditional Chinese medicine, which needs to be boiled before drinking, and has more contraindications than western medicine. For example, you cannot eat spicy food or drink alcohol while taking Chinese medicine. Mutton is a kind of meat that people are familiar with. Mutton is a kind of food that can cause inflammation and has a strong smell of mutton. So do we need to avoid eating mutton when taking traditional Chinese medicine? Can I eat mutton while taking Chinese medicine? 1. Mutton is a kind of meat that is hot in nature. Regular consumption of this meat can replenish energy for our body. At the same time, mutton can also replenish essence and blood, relieve lung deficiency, and improve fatigue. However, drinking Chinese medicine and eating mutton will not produce ideal treatment results. 2. Do not eat irritating foods when taking Chinese medicine. The scope of irritating foods is very broad, and sometimes even meat and fish are considered irritating foods. Therefore, you cannot eat mutton while taking Chinese medicine. 3. In addition, mutton has a fishy smell. Generally, Chinese medicine has an aromatic smell, especially aromatic dehumidifying and aromatic qi-regulating medicines, which contain a large amount of volatile oils to exert their therapeutic effects. These aromatic substances are the most incompatible with fishy smells. If you do not avoid fishy smell when taking Chinese medicine, it will often affect the efficacy of the medicine. 4. Friends who take Chinese medicine also need to stay away from raw, cold and spicy foods, as such foods will affect the therapeutic effects of our medicines. How long after taking Chinese medicine can I eat mutton? Eating mutton immediately after taking Chinese medicine will have a certain impact on the medicinal properties of the medicine, so it is not recommended to eat mutton after taking Chinese medicine. Generally speaking, decocted Chinese medicine is in liquid form and is digested and absorbed relatively quickly in the body. You can eat mutton 2 hours after drinking the Chinese medicine. Taboos of taking Chinese medicine Never drink strong tea when taking Chinese medicine, because tea contains tannic acid. If taken at the same time as Chinese medicine, it will affect the body's absorption of the active ingredients in the medicine and reduce its efficacy. Never eat radish while taking Chinese medicine, because radish has the effects of helping food and breaking up gas. Especially when taking tonic Chinese medicine such as ginseng, eating radish will not only reduce the effect of the tonic, but may also affect the tonic effect of the medicine. Patients with digestive tract diseases such as hepatitis and chronic gastroenteritis should never eat garlic while taking spleen-strengthening, stomach-warming and stomach-regulating medicines. Because garlic contains allicin, which can irritate the gastrointestinal mucosa, making the Chinese medicine taken unable to effectively play its therapeutic role. |
